How to Format a Mechanical Engineer CV
Start with a Clear Objective
Begin your CV with a clear, concise objective that aligns with the mechanical engineering role you’re applying for. This should succinctly state your career goals and how you plan to contribute to the prospective company. Highlighting your passion for the field and your readiness to innovate within it sets a positive tone for the rest of your CV.Highlight Education and Certifications
Your educational background and any relevant certifications (like PE licensure) are crucial. Format this section to list your degree, any mechanical engineering courses, and certifications at the top, as they are your primary qualifications. This layout helps hiring managers quickly verify your engineering fundamentals and theoretical knowledge.Detail Relevant Experience and Projects
Detailing internships, part-time jobs, or projects where you utilized mechanical engineering skills is vital. Use bullet points to describe responsibilities and achievements, focusing on tasks that demonstrate your analytical skills, proficiency with CAD software, and any experience with mechanical design or manufacturing processes.Emphasize Technical Skills and Software Proficiencies
Technical skills like proficiency in CAD software, understanding of manufacturing processes, and knowledge of material properties are as crucial as soft skills. Include a section that balances both, highlighting your proficiency in engineering software (e.g., AutoCAD, SolidWorks) and your ability to work well in a team. This shows you’re not only capable of handling the technical aspects but also of contributing positively to the company culture.Personal Statements for Mechanical Engineers

What Makes a Strong Personal Statement?
A strong personal statement for a Mechanical Engineer CV seamlessly blends professional achievements with specific engineering skills, clearly demonstrating the candidate's value through measurable outcomes. It stands out by being highly tailored to the mechanical engineering field, highlighting expertise in areas like product design, manufacturing processes, and energy systems, directly addressing how these skills meet the needs of the prospective employer.

CV FAQs for Mechanical Engineers
How long should Mechanical Engineers make a CV?
The ideal length for a Mechanical Engineer's CV is typically 1-2 pages. This allows sufficient room to showcase your technical skills, project experience, and professional achievements without overloading the reader. Prioritize information that directly relates to the role you're applying for, emphasizing key engineering successes that reflect your capabilities and potential in similar positions.
What's the best format for a Mechanical Engineer CV?
The best format for a Mechanical Engineer CV is the reverse-chronological layout. This format highlights your most recent and relevant engineering experiences first, demonstrating your career progression and key achievements in the field. It allows employers to quickly assess your growth and engineering expertise. Each section should be tailored to emphasize engineering-specific skills, certifications, and accomplishments, aligning closely with the job you're applying for.
How can I make my Mechanical Engineer CV stand out?
To make your Mechanical Engineer CV stand out, highlight your technical skills, certifications, and project experiences. Use metrics to demonstrate your impact on efficiency, cost reduction, or product improvement. Showcase your proficiency in CAD software, simulation tools, or specialized machinery. Tailor your CV to the job description, using similar language to resonate with hiring managers. Don't forget to mention any industry-specific training or professional development courses you've completed.
